История развития баз данных: когда появились первые СУБД и как они изменили мир информационных технологий

Первые системы управления базами данных (СУБД) появились в 1960-х годах. Одной из самых известных и первых СУБД была система IMS (Information Management System), разработанная фирмой IBM уже в 1966 году.

Вот пример создания базы данных и таблицы с использованием языка SQL:


CREATE DATABASE example_database;
USE example_database;
CREATE TABLE example_table (
    id INT PRIMARY KEY,
    name VARCHAR(50),
    age INT
);
    

Этот пример создает базу данных под названием "example_database" и таблицу под названием "example_table" с тремя столбцами: "id" типа INT, "name" типа VARCHAR(50) и "age" типа INT.

Надеюсь, это помогло!

Детальный ответ

Когда появились первые СУБД

Системы управления базами данных (СУБД) - одна из ключевых компонентов современных информационных технологий. Они обеспечивают эффективное хранение и обработку данных, что является неотъемлемой частью работы любого предприятия или организации.

Но когда точно появились первые СУБД? История начала развития СУБД связана с прогрессом различных компьютерных технологий и идеями управления данными. Давайте рассмотрим эту историю подробнее.

Ранние системы управления базами данных

Первые предшественники СУБД появились в 1960-х годах. Одним из первых примеров является иерархическая система управления базой данных (ИСУБД), которая основана на модели иерархической структуры данных. Примером такой системы является IBM's Information Management System (IMS), которая была разработана в 1960 году.

Затем, в 1970-х годах, появилась сетевая модель управления базами данных. Она позволяла связывать данные с применением различных типов отношений, что позволяло гибко представлять структуру базы данных. Примером такой системы является IDS2 (Integrated Data Store 2), которая была разработана в 1972 году.

Пионеры реляционных СУБД

Наибольший прорыв в развитии СУБД произошел с появлением реляционных систем управления базами данных (РСУБД). Работа над реляционной моделью началась в 1970 году и стала одной из основных вех в истории СУБД.

В 1970 году Э. Кодд из IBM выпустил статью, где представил реляционную модель данных. В этой модели данные представлены в виде таблиц, которые состоят из строк и столбцов. Реляционная модель была основана на математических основах и привнесла в СУБД новые возможности, такие как использование стандартизированного языка запросов, независимости от физического хранения данных и гибкость представления информации.

Первая коммерческая реляционная СУБД была разработана в 1976 году. Это была система под названием SQL/DS (Structured Query Language/Data System), созданная компанией IBM. SQL/DS предоставила возможность работы с данными с помощью SQL - языком, стандартизированным в 1974 году.

Вскоре после появления SQL/DS, другие компании также начали разрабатывать реляционные СУБД. Примером такой системы является Oracle, которая появилась в 1979 году.

СУБД в современной эпохе

С течением времени, СУБД стали все более развитыми и мощными. Сегодня существует огромное количество различных реляционных и нереляционных СУБД, каждая со своими особенностями и возможностями.

Расширение интернета и взрывной рост объема данных привели к развитию таких технологий, как NoSQL и NewSQL. Эти системы предлагают новые подходы к хранению и обработке данных, обеспечивая масштабируемость и высокую производительность.

Кроме того, появление облачных технологий также изменило способ работы с данными. Сейчас многие СУБД предлагают возможность развертывать и управлять базами данных в облаке, что дает гибкость и мобильность в работе с данными.

Пример кода для создания таблицы в реляционной СУБД


CREATE TABLE employees (
    id INT PRIMARY KEY,
    name VARCHAR(50),
    age INT,
    department VARCHAR(50)
);

Этот пример кода демонстрирует создание таблицы "employees" с несколькими столбцами: "id", "name", "age", и "department". С помощью этой таблицы можно хранить информацию о сотрудниках, включая их идентификатор, имя, возраст и отдел.

Заключение

СУБД - это важный инструмент, который помогает организациям эффективно управлять своими данными. Они появились в результате прогресса в области компьютерных технологий и идей управления данными. Ранние системы управления базами данных были иерархическими и сетевыми, но с появлением реляционных СУБД произошел значительный сдвиг в развитии технологии.

Сегодня СУБД продолжают развиваться, предлагая новые функциональности и возможности. Они играют важную роль в современном мире информационных технологий и будут продолжать эволюционировать в будущем, сопровождая прогресс компьютерных технологий.

Видео по теме

Что такое СУБД

1. История появления СУБД Oracle

1 История СУБД · Константин Осипов

Похожие статьи:

История развития баз данных: когда появились первые СУБД и как они изменили мир информационных технологий

Что входит в функции СУБД тест: основные аспекты и принципы